: What do y'all think of a hobbit movie as a prequel to LOTR. We all know the tones of each are completely different, the Hobbit being geared towards a younger crowd. So... : Should the Hobbit movie go off on its own? Creating a whole new paradigm, a whole new feel, in effect a whole new world that is only peripherally related to that of the LOTR trilogy of movies? : Or should it be "tweaked" (with some parts being outright dumped) to make it more compatible? Well it wouldn't be the first time The Hobbit has been tweaked to fit in better with The Lord of the Rings. The first edition is significantly different to the versions of the book we see today particularly with regard to how Bilbo got the ring. I would like to see a proper movie of The Hobbit and I think that some very minor areas could be "improved" to fit better, references to goblins could be changed to orcs, the Rivendell scenes could possibly use sets from the LoTR movie, Thranduil could be named (we might even catch a glimpse of Legolas) etc. I wouldn't really like to see to much fiddling though just for the sake of fitting in with the Peter Jackson project. Part of the books charm is that it was written for children, I think updating it for adults would be a disaster. : Me? I see both points, but I tend to think it should be made a bit more "compatible." But I'm not sure. (Hence this poll.) : Dave C-Q
